Handover for Marrowgate validator-plugin review.

Plugins are sandboxed per-tenant; bundles must be signed before the loader accepts them. Known gaps: unsigned plugins still load in dev mode, and the registry allows version downgrades. Audit focus should be the loader's trust checks and sandbox escape surface. The production loader runs with the following configuration values.

service settings:
[oliix]
team = noveth
access_code = ac_4de949
host = oliix.novachq.corp
port = 8080
owner = wenir.casion
peer = wenys.lumicstack.corp

Subject: Retirement of the Vanta 300 Line

Executive team: we will retire the Vanta 300 product line at fiscal year-end. Demand has fallen 40% over two years; margins are negative. Support continues 18 months for existing customers. Inventory wind-down plan attached. Board approval requested at next session. The rationale is summarized in the restricted note below.

board note of tadup-tajog: Headcount on the Oliiel team goes from 31 to 88 by the end of February. Gross margin on Oliiel came in at 62 percent against a plan of 29 percent.

**Authentication**

Heads up, plugin authors: the Gearloft CI agents sign every request with a timestamp, and our gateway rejects anything more than 45 seconds off. If your plugin runs on a skewed agent, you'll see mysterious 401s that look like bad credentials — check the clock first. We can't fix your agents' NTP for you, but we can give you a skew-tolerant test endpoint. To hit it during development, authenticate with the key below.

gateway credential: kto3_qfe

TICKET: VEIL-CLI-418

Component: veiltail (internal log-tailing CLI)
Severity: Medium

veiltail drops the final partial line when a stream closes mid-record, so tails against the Copperhatch aggregator silently truncate. Fixed by buffering until newline or EOF flush. Note for maintainers: the flush path also runs on SIGINT now; don't remove it or rotated files lose their tail again. Regression test added in tail_flush_test. Verified against staging on the Marrowick cluster. The build under which the fix was validated is:

trace token, kawip-fafog: htk14_26e64c4d35154e